enPR: pǐngʹdǐngʹshänʹ Etymology: From the Hanyu Pinyin romanization of the Mandarin 平頂山/平顶山 (Píngdǐngshān). Etymology templates: {{bor|en|cmn-pinyin|-}} Hanyu Pinyin, {{bor|en|cmn|平頂山}} Mandarin 平頂山/平顶山 (Píngdǐngshān) Head templates: {{en-proper noun}} Pingdingshan
  1. A prefecture-level city in Henan, China.
